Registered Nurse (RN)

The Registered Nurse is accountable for interpreting the medical care plan, assessing patients' clinical decision-making regarding nursing care, ensuring that nursing care is delivered competently and safely, providing personalized nursing care, and evaluating nursing care across patient groups.

Essential Functions

  • Maintain accurate and detailed reports and records.
  • Administer medications to patients and monitor them for reactions or side effects.
  • Record patients' medical information and vital signs.
  • Monitor, document, and report symptoms or changes in patients' conditions.
  • Consult and coordinate with healthcare team members to assess, plan, implement, or evaluate patient care plans.
  • Modify patient treatment plans based on patients' responses and conditions.

Qualifications

  • Associate's Degree in Nursing required; Bachelor's Degree in Nursing preferred.
  • Registered Nurse (RN) license required.
  • 0-1 year of clinical nursing experience required.

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ities

  • Familiarity with practical nursing principles and skills to provide effective patient care and treatment.
  • Knowledge of care requirements for various age groups.
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ality and secure sensitive information.
  • Knowledge of medical terminology.
  • Excellent verbal and communication skills.
  • Ability to accurately screen and triage acute patients.
